Munduk is a highland plantation village in north-central Bali. It is a center for the growing of coffee and cloves. The village is located on a high ridge within close distance to highland volcanic lakes such as Tamblingan,
Buyan and
Bratan.

At Munduk you can find some accommodation in the form of Dutch Colonial-Chinese bungalows built in the 1920's. Perhaps the most famous resident of the village is I Made Trip, Bali's most famous bamboo instrument maker.
Munduk makes an ideal base for you to explore the surrounding highlands. There are bicycles available for rental here. You can either cycle or take long walks to visit the surrounding ricefields and enjoy the panoramic views here.
There is a number of waterfalls in Munduk, the biggest having a 30-meter drop. It is located on the road towards
Bedugul.
